Technology is often considered very closely paired to science and engineering. In this idea, technology is the employment of science with engineering. In this way, scientists engage in research to fathom the facts of the world around us, and it is the job of engineers to define the devices and similar elements based on the scientists conclusions, to take advantage of natures resources for the profit of men. Technicians are then asked to construct and uphold the components.
Technology might also allude to utensils and gadgets that men have employed in clearing up real-world dilemmas. This might involve plain hand utensils like the axe, or intricate phenomena like space stations. These instruments or gadgets need not be merely gross material, but might be a lot more indirect for example computer software.
The period from 2.5 million to 10000 BC is termed as the "Old Stone Age", and human forefathers introduced instruments fashioned from stones including flint. The stone tools were merely splintered rocks, but more recently took the appearance like that of the axe. Then fire was found, which gave the opportunity to early men to prepare their eatables for easier digestibility. Clothing was made with fur and hides, which made it possible for humans to live in cool locations.
Later the polished stone axe of the "New Stone Age" permitted everyone to clean away forest to produce farms. Agriculture unfolded, a larger amount of people could be carried, and villages progressed from villages into cities.
Circa 8000 BC, copper in its unchanged form was utilised for instruments. Some metals like silver and lead used to be also employed for work equipment. Some time later, bronze and brass, in just about every case are alloys, were isolated in 4000 BC.Approximately 1400 BC, iron was exploited.
The fabrication of the wheel in approx 4000 BC caused an upheaval how we get around. Its benefits as windmills and water wheels led to broad harnessing of wind and water systems.
